In that sense, the first full-length novel by author Seo Eun-chae, Way Back Love, is a fantasy novel but could also be a type of practical guide to life.

 

Way Back Love is a novel that focuses on the story of Hui-wan's first love, Ram-u, who died a long time ago and returns as a grim reaper to visit her, making readers look back on the birth and preciousness of family and what love is, centering on Hui-wan, Ram-u, and their families. In the novel, Ram-u creates the will to live for Hui-wan, who has lost her motivation for life, with a bucket list such as a cherry blossom festival date.

 

It is a novel that quickly unfolds a time like a spring miracle experienced by the protagonist Hui-wan from the perspectives of various characters with a short breath resembling a web novel. Centering on the fulfillment of the spring bucket list by Hui-wan and Ram-u, each chapter focuses on the stories of individual characters.
